Account recovery — SnackRoute restock planner. If a planner account locks after failed logins, verify identity with the shift lead, then reset via the Depot admin page. Do not create duplicate accounts; route history breaks. If the admin page itself is inaccessible, use the fallback operator login. The fallback login requires the recovery passphrase, given here:

vault phrase of tawef-baduf = julox-eliir-ulaix-rusok-novael-sorael-tammir-ulaok-casvan-rusius-olimir-kasath-kelius

Q: Why does this PR change the health-check path on Fernlight's load balancer?

A: Good catch, but it's intentional. The old /ping endpoint only proved the process was alive; it happily returned 200 while the database pool was exhausted. The new /healthz does a shallow dependency check with a 500ms budget, so the balancer can actually drain sick nodes. Don't let anyone add slow checks there — flapping instances are worse than dumb ones. The full health-check policy and timeout rationale are documented on the internal page here.

operations page: https://jenkins.zemvarcloud.local/job/merge_requests/repo/build/73930b4b30f0a8ed

// Client setup for the Splitgrove assignment service.
// Plugin authors: assignments are resolved server-side; do not cache
// variant results locally for longer than the session. The client
// retries twice on timeout, then falls back to the control arm.
// Initialize against the sandbox endpoint first and verify your
// experiment slug resolves. Authenticate the client with the key below.

service key, hawif-kadup: vxb7-VMYtoba

To the Brackley Point site team: the initial key-card stock for the new annex arrives this week via our usual courier, Fernwall Secure Transit. The consignment contains 240 unprogrammed cards plus 12 pre-encoded master cards for facilities staff, packed in two sealed tins. Count both tins on arrival and log any broken seals before accepting. Store the masters in the comms-room safe until the access system goes live next Monday. For the exchange itself, the courier has been told to follow the instruction below.

drop instructions, bagug-kagup: the rusath julmir courier leaves the ralwyn aldok eliius ledger at gate 8603 under passcode 993062